What is a Blog?

A blog is a website or section of a website that features regularly updated content, typically in the form of written articles or posts. 

Blogs can cover various topics, from personal reflections and experiences to news and current events, and can be written by individuals or organizations. 

At the same time, blogs often include interactive features such as comments, which allow readers to engage with the content and the author. 

It is not enough to know about this; you need to know about blogging.

What is Blogging?

At its core, blogging is creating and publishing content on the internet (the blog). This content can be written posts, videos, images, or audio and can be on any given topic. 

It is maintaining the blog, which is a great way to share your opinion, ideas, and experiences with the world.

To customize a WordPress.com blog in Canada, you can follow these steps:

  • Log in to your WordPress.com account and go to your dashboard.
  • From the dashboard, click on the “Appearance” tab on the left-hand side menu.
  • Under “Appearance,” you will find several options for customizing your blog, including “Themes,” “Customize,” and “Widgets.”
  • To change the theme of your blog, click on the “Themes” tab. You can browse through available themes and preview their look on your blog. When you find a theme, click the “Activate” button to apply the theme to your blog.
  • To further customize your blog, click on the “Customize” tab. From here, you can adjust the settings for various aspects of your blog, such as the colors, fonts, and layout.
  • Click on the “Widgets” tab to add widgets to your blog. Widgets are small blocks of content that you can add to different areas of your blog, such as the sidebar or footer. From the “Widgets” tab, you can add, remove, and rearrange widgets as needed.

Keep in mind that the customization options available on WordPress.com may be limited compared to the self-hosted version of WordPress. 

However, you can still customize your blog to give it a unique look and feel.

Can you monetize a free blog?

Once you have a blog up with some traffic, you can start thinking about monetization.

But the question is, can you make money with a free blog in Canada?

Yes, it is possible to monetize a free blog. And there are several ways you can do this:

  • Advertising: You can display ads on your blog and earn money through pay-per-click (PPC) or cost-per-impression (CPM) advertising programs such as Google AdSense.
  • Sponsored content: You can work with brands to create sponsored content on your blog. This typically involves writing a post or creating a video that promotes a product or service in exchange for a fee.
  • Affiliate marketing: You can earn a commission by promoting products or services from other companies on your blog and linking to those products or services using an affiliate link. You earn a commission when someone clicks on the link and makes a purchase.
  • Sell digital products: You can create and sell digital products such as ebooks, courses, or printables on your blog.
  • Offer services: You can use your blog to offer consulting, coaching, or freelance writing services.

NOTE: Monetizing a blog takes time and effort, and it may not be an immediate source of income. 

However, with consistent effort and a solid monetization strategy, it is possible to earn money from a free blog in Canada.

Downsides of starting a free blog in Canada

What can beat ‘free?’

Nothing!

The opposite of a free blog is a self-hosted blog. This is one where you pay for hosting and probably the domain name.

But why would anyone pay if there’s a free option?

Well, there are a few potential downsides to starting a free blog in Canada:

  • Limited control: When you create a free blog, you typically do so on a blogging platform such as WordPress.com or Blogger. This means that you don’t have full control over your blog and are subject to the terms and conditions of the platform. This can be frustrating if you want to customize your blog or do things not allowed by the platform.
  • Limited monetization options: Some free blogging platforms restrict how you can monetize your blog, or they may take a percentage of your earnings as a fee. This can make it harder to earn money from your blog.
  • Branding limitations: With a free blog, you often don’t have the option to use your domain name and may have to use a subdomain (e.g., yourblog.wordpress.com). This can make establishing your brand harder and make your blog look less professional.
  • Limited storage and bandwidth: Free blogging platforms often limit your storage and bandwidth, which can be a problem if your blog becomes popular and receives a lot of traffic.
  • No ownership: Because you do not own the platform or domain name for a free blog, you do not have full control over it. If the platform decides to shut down or change its terms and conditions, you could lose your blog and all your created content.

While free blogging platforms in Canada can be a good option for those who are just starting and want to try blogging without making a financial investment, they may not be the best choice for those who want more control, customization, and monetization options for their blog.
